Since the FE team has an obvious infatuation with WC3 I think they should go full rip-off mode. I know the World Editor is in another dimension compared to aoe2’s integrated one, but there’s some stuff I believe would be possible to integrate.

  • Particle weather effects (map-wide or localized): Rain, blizzard, sun/moon rays, fog.
  • Improve the “night” map lighting into something more of just a bad washed out colour mood.
  • Tall city walls that function like cliffs.
  • Extra player colours.
  • Show radius on Map Revealer objects while in the editor.
  • Add LOS blockers.
  • Remove the engine cap on LOS.
  • Allow parentheses with strings on object names shown in the editor but not in-game.
  • Cinematic letterboxes, with the ability to turn off AI in the middle of “cutscenes”.
  • As always, more and more eyecandy objects, units, buildings, terrains, triggers, whatever!

Adding in sub-maps able to carry over information inside variables would open up crazy possibilities, though that one might be very overambitious. Think the Founding of Durotar campaign from WC3.
